Abstract

The invention discloses an excavation device of a bridge pier foundation. The excavation device comprises a bearing platform (1) and a bi-directional hydraulic device (2) fixed to the bearing platform (1), wherein the bearing platform (1) comprises a bearing platform body (11), a main shaft (12), and at least two supporting feet (13) arranged below the bearing platform body (11); the main shaft (12) penetrates through the middle of the bearing platform body (11), and is detachably fixed to the bearing platform body (11); a rotary excavation cutting head (5) is connected and arranged at the bottom of the main shaft (12) through a universal rotating shaft (4); a slurry pulp (3) is arranged in the middle of the main shaft (12); a slurry circulation channel (131) is arranged inside the main shaft (12); and the slurry pulp (3) communicates with slurry circulation channel (131). Through the implementation of the excavation device of the bridge pier foundation, the slurry pump removing process can be carried out during the pier foundation excavation process, so that the working efficiency is improved, and the working environment is guaranteed to be safe.

technical field [0001] The invention relates to the construction field, in particular to a bridge pier pier foundation excavation equipment. Background technique [0002] At present, the excavation of bridge pier foundations mainly relies on rotary excavation of pile foundations or manual excavation. This method cannot quickly excavate bridge pier foundations, and the work efficiency is extremely low. When the pier foundation is excavated, there will often be a lot of mud, etc., which is an additional step of removing the mud, and this step is often carried out after the pier foundation is completed, that is to say, the pier foundation Excavation and mud extraction are carried out separately and step by step, which not only increases the construction volume, but also prolongs the construction time, thereby reducing work efficiency.
